International Development is the study and practice of improving social, economic, and political conditions in countries around the world. It focuses on issues such as poverty reduction, education, health, human rights, sustainable development, and global inequality. The field examines the roles of governments, international organizations, NGOs, and communities in designing and implementing development programs. By understanding international development, professionals can create policies and projects that promote economic growth, social justice, and sustainable progress in diverse global contexts.
Course Curriculum
- Module 01: Measurement and Morality in International Development
- Module 02: Governance and Development
- Module 03: Global Health and Development
- Module 04: Gender and Development
- Module 05: Global Poverty, Inequality and Development
- Module 06: Economic Development
- Module 07: Environment and Development
- Module 08: Innovation and Technology
- Module 09: International Migration and Development
- Module 10: Theories of Development and Globalisation
- Module 11: An International Development Actor
